logo

Output ec53500c1589c082ce25f19080043983a72496cb886bd891fe591e83745956e9:1

value
28198817
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e1624ba6c2ada931e7d35196dd8f9f98831ec47 OP_EQUALVERIFY OP_CHECKSIG
address
15CgcP1S1pdW9Y4PftysQQu5ngnxJhNQzX
transaction
ec53500c1589c082ce25f19080043983a72496cb886bd891fe591e83745956e9